16 Example Sentences Showcasing the Meaning of 'Re-evaluate'

The archaeologists plan to re-evaluate the excavation site in search of additional artifacts.

Faced with economic challenges, the government decided to re-evaluate its fiscal policies.

The city officials had to re-evaluate the urban development plan after considering environmental concerns.

The detective had to re-evaluate the evidence to solve the mysterious case that had puzzled the police force.

Scientists often re-evaluate their hypotheses based on new experimental data and research findings.

The board of directors decided to re-evaluate the company's long-term goals in light of changing industry dynamics.

After receiving constructive criticism, the author took the opportunity to re-evaluate and revise the manuscript.

In astronomy, scientists re-evaluate their understanding of celestial bodies as new telescopic technologies emerge.

Facing unexpected challenges, the astronaut had to re-evaluate the mission parameters for the upcoming space expedition.

In light of recent technological advancements, the company decided to re-evaluate its digital marketing strategies.

The chef constantly seeks to re-evaluate and refine recipes to meet the evolving tastes of the restaurant's clientele.

Recognizing the evolving market trends, the entrepreneur chose to re-evaluate the business plan for the startup.

Faced with changing weather patterns, the meteorologists had to re-evaluate their predictions for the upcoming week.

As part of the research process, the sociologist decided to re-evaluate the survey questions to ensure accurate data collection.

In light of new medical research findings, the doctor advised the patient to re-evaluate their lifestyle choices for better health.

The software developer had to re-evaluate the coding structure to enhance the program's efficiency and performance.
